Neusticosaurus peyeri

Growth series of Neusticosaurus peyeri, a middle Triassic marine reptile from the UNESCO site of Monte San Giorgio in Switzerland (see Sander 1989; O'Keefe et al. 1989). These fossils are deposited in the collections of the Palaeontologisches Institut und Museum der Universität Zürich (PIMUZ). Pictures are not to scale; the skeletal lengths from left to right are 5, 9.5, 16, 22 and 37 cm. Photos Copyright of the PIMUZ
